Patent number: 11494045Abstract: An electronic apparatus and an object information recognition method by using touch data thereof are provided. Touch sensing is performed in the case where no object touches a touch panel to obtain a specific background frame through the touch panel. A current touch sensing frame is obtained through the touch panel. Touch background data of a plurality of first frame cells in the specific background frame is respectively subtracted from touch raw data of a plurality of second frame cells in the current touch sensing frame to obtain a background removal frame including a plurality of cell values. The background removal frame is transformed into a touch sensing image. The touch sensing image is inputted to a trained neural network model to recognize object information of a touch object.Type: GrantFiled: December 19, 2019Date of Patent: November 8, 2022Assignee: Acer IncorporatedInventors: Chih-Wen Huang, Eric Choi, Wen-Cheng Hsu, Chao-Kuang Yang, Yen-Shuo Huang, Ling-Fan Tsao, Chueh-Pin Ko, Chih-Chiang Chen, Tai Ju

Publication number: 20220286658Abstract: A stereo image generation method and an electronic apparatus using the same are provided. The stereo image generation method includes the following steps. A two-dimensional (2D) original image corresponding to a first viewing angle is obtained, and a depth map of the 2D original image is estimated. Interpupillary distance information of a user is detected. A pixel shift processing is performed on the 2D original image according to the interpupillary distance information and the depth map to generate a reference image corresponding to a second viewing angle. An image inpainting processing is performed on the reference image to obtain a restored image. The restored image and the 2D original image are merged to generate a stereo image conforming to a stereo image format.Type: ApplicationFiled: January 24, 2022Publication date: September 8, 2022Applicant: Acer IncorporatedInventors: Chih-Haw Tan, Wen-Cheng Hsu, Chih-Wen Huang, Shih-Hao Lin, Sergio Cantero Clares

Patent number: 11387199Abstract: A gallium arsenide (GaAs) radio frequency (RF) circuit is disclosed. The GaAs RF circuit includes a power amplifier and a low noise amplifier; a first transmit/receive (TR) switch, coupled to the power amplifier and the low noise amplifier, wherein the first TR switch is fabricated by a pHEMT (Pseudomorphic High Electron Mobility Transistor) process; and a first active phase shifter, coupled to the power amplifier or the low noise amplifier, wherein the first active phase shifter is fabricated by an HBT (Heterojunction Bipolar Transistor) process; wherein the GaAs RF circuit is formed within a GaAs die.Type: GrantFiled: February 14, 2020Date of Patent: July 12, 2022Assignee: WIN Semiconductors Corp.Inventors: Shao-Cheng Hsiao, Chih-Wen Huang, Jui-Chieh Chiu, Po-Kie Tseng
